The Site Engineer position supports field activities and assists Project Managers and Superintendents. They assist with project planning and tracking; material tracking and pricing; and project cost reporting, typically supporting one medium to large-size project. Site Engineers learns the fundamentals of Geotechnical Construction and field technical services. This is a field/project-based leadership position that is focused on site operations.
Responsibilities- Assists in managing the project schedule, supervises Quality Control (QC) and ensures compliance with QC requirements
- Coordinates Third Party QC services, implements RECON’s three phase QC program and prepares Daily Production Logs
- Responsible for planning, scheduling, conducting, and coordinating the technical and management aspects of projects, prepares monthly project status reports and change orders
- Budget monitoring and trend tracking
- Observes and complies with all company specific site safety programs, assists the Site Safety Officer with accident/incident investigations, finds the root cause and suggests improvements
- Works independently and conducts tasks with limited supervision
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or similar type degree required
- Four years of engineering experience or similar trade; Construction field experience preferred
- Experience with surveying or CAD
- Experience demonstrating progressive increase in financial/supervisory accountability and authority
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Knowledge of Microsoft Office products such as Word, Excel, and Project
- Must be self-motivated and able to work effectively with little or no direct supervision
- Must possess multi-tasking skills
